Chief of Turkey’s General Staff released from hostage

11:10, 16 July, 2016

YEREVAN, JULY 16, ARMENPRESS. Chief of General Staff of the Turkish Armed Forces Hulusi Akar who has been taken hostage by the initiators of the coup d'état, has been released from hostage, Hurriyet reports.

It has been found out that he was removed from the headquarters of the Turkish Armed Forces to the Akıncılar Base where the initiators of the coup used as one of their centers to command their attempt.

Akar was taken to an unknown place. His health is believed to be fine.

Earlier it was reported that Hulusi Akar has been killed.
